- The distance between Le Mars, Ia, Usa and Maine Soroa, Niger is approximately 10,414 km or 6,471 mi.
- To reach Le Mars, Ia in this distance one would set out from Maine Soroa bearing 315.8°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Le Mars, Ia bearing 248.1° or WSW .
- Le Mars, Ia has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Maine Soroa has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Le Mars, Ia is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Maine Soroa is in or near the tropical very dry for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 20 °C (36°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 21.3 °C (38.3°F) more in Le Mars, Ia.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 327.3 mm (12.9 in) more which is equivalent to 327.3 l/m² (8.03 US gal/ft²) or 3,273,000 l/ha (349,905 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 25.5° lower in Le Mars, Ia than in Maine Soroa.
